About Frederick E. Martin at a glance
Frederick E. Martin is an Asst. U.S. Atty. based in Lewisburg, Pennsylvania. They have 52+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1974. Their practice focuses on criminal defense, federal crimes, and litigation. Admitted to practice in Maryland (1974) and Pennsylvania (1989). Educated at Georgetown University (J.D., 1974) and Marquette University (B.A., 1970). Serves clients in Lewisburg, PA and the surrounding metropolitan area.
